The same symbol pulled in from libc_pic.a and dl-allobjs.os?


Team,

One of my automated builders recently failed to build glibc git trunk
for hppa-linux with the following failure:
~~~
gcc   -nostdlib -nostartfiles -r -o
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/elf/librtld.map.o '-Wl,-('
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/elf/dl-allobjs.os
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/libc_pic.a -lgcc '-Wl,-)'
-Wl,-Map,/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/elf/librtld.mapT
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/libc_pic.a(dl-addr.os): In
function `_dl_addr_inside_object':
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/src/glibc/elf/dl-addr.c:157: multiple
definition of `_dl_addr_inside_object'
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/elf/dl-allobjs.os:/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/src/glibc/elf/dl-open.c:672:
first defined here
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/libc_pic.a(_itoa.os): In
function `_itoa':
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/src/glibc/stdio-common/_itoa.c:215:
multiple definition of `_itoa'
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/elf/dl-allobjs.os:/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/src/glibc/elf/dl-minimal.c:300:
first defined here
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/libc_pic.a(init-first.os):(.data+0x0):
multiple definition of `__libc_multiple_libcs'
/home/carlos/fsrc/glibc-work/builds/glibc/elf/dl-allobjs.os:(.bss+0x7c):
first defined here
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
~~~

Has anyone else seen this?
